PDA

View Full Version : Hướng dẫn đưa Maple lên Hamachi



pthinh145
31-03-13, 12:21 AM
Do có nhiều bạn hỏi mình cách để đưa MS lên Hamachi nên mình lập topic này cho những ai chưa biết
Để đưa lên Hamachi các bạn phải cài đc MS offline trước
Hướng dẫn: <b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
Đầu tiên các bạn cần 1 file setup hamachi: <b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
Redirector cho bạn nào xài V114: <b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b> (do Redirector mới bên v114 của mình mở hamachi đăng nhập vào là văng nên ko xài cho v114 đc)
Notepad ++: <b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b> (dùng để config)
AppServ 2.6.0: <b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
và 1 web dành cho Maple ở đây mình xài web của Sandaru: <b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
đầu tiên các bạn cài hamachi (cái này quá dễ ko cần phải nói) sau đó nhấn vào cái nút Power để mở IP hamachi, típ tục Create a new network để tạo 1 room hamachi
NetBeans: <b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b> tải bản full nhé (cái này mình hd sau) :P
Tới AppServ: mở lên và next đến đây và bỏ các dấu như hình
<b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
<b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
cái email điền email của bạn cũng đc, sao đó cài đặt. Vào nơi mà bạn cài đặt AppServ => <b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b> xóa hết tất cả trong ấy, xả hết mấy thứ trong web của Sandaru vào
sau đó chuột phải vào config.inc.php trong s-inc/config.inc.php và config cho đúng với mysql và server của bạn, sau đó execute file s.sql trong web vào table của sv trong Mysql query
đây là config.inc.php của mình:


<?
session_start();
ob_start();
######### Starting Code
# ==> Include need source
# ==> Request and config
# ==> Copyright Xephyr 2013
######### First - Config
/*======== MySQL Config*/
$config['MySQL']['Server'] = "localhost";
$config['MySQL']['Username'] = "root";
$config['MySQL']['Password'] = "root";
$config['MySQL']['Database'] = "v114";
########## Server MS Config
$config['Server']['IP'] = "Chỗ này đổi thành IP hamachi của bạn";
$config['Server']['Port'] = "80";
/*======== Site Config*/
$config['Site']['Name'] = "Xephyr MS ^^!";
$config['Site']['Domain'] = "localhost/sms";//Ko <b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b> | ko / cuối
$config['Site']['Message'] = "Chào mừng các bạn đến với XephyrMS v114 ^^!";// Dòng chữ loa chạy trên web
$config['Site']['Version'] = 114;
$config['Site']['EXP_RATE'] = 2;
$config['Site']['MESO_RATE'] = 1;
$config['Site']['DROP_RATE'] = 1;
$config['Site']['DESCRIPTION'] = "BLah blah blah blah blah blah";
$config['Site']['Forum_Link'] = "<b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>";// Link forum - full link
$config['Site']['Change_Name_Cre'] = 50;//Phí đổi tên nhân vật
########## Nạp Thẻ Config [ Sử dụng GameBank.vn để nạp ^^!]
$config['Site']['GameBankVN_Account'] = "Xephyr";
$menhgia = array(
10000 => 2000,//10k sẽ nhận 1k points
20000 => 2000,//20k sẽ nhận 2k points
30000 => 3000,//30k sẽ nhận 3k points
50000 => 5500,
100000 => 11000,
200000 => 22000,
500000 => 55000,
);
########## Download Config
$config['Download']['Full_Client'] = "<b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>";//Link client chinh
$config['Download']['MS_EXE'] = "<b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>";//Link localhost.exe chinh
########## Supporter
$config['Site']['Yahoo_SP'] = "Điền Yahoo của bạn";
$config['Site']['Skype_SP'] = "Điền Skype của bạn";
/*======== End Config*/
################################################## #############################
######### Don't edit this. Might be error
################################################## #############################
######### Second - Include

require_once("mysql.class.php");

######### Third - Calling

$db = new MySQL();
$db->connect($config['MySQL']['Server'], $config['MySQL']['Username'], $config['MySQL']['Password'], $config['MySQL']['Database']);
$db->select_db($config['MySQL']['Database']);
// Done MySQL

?>
<?
### My Own Function
function protect_sql( $sCode ) {
if (function_exists("mysql_real_escape_string" ) ) {
$sCode = mysql_real_escape_string( $sCode );
} else {
$sCode = addslashes( $sCode );
}
return $sCode;
}
function session_registered($variable) {
if (PHP_VERSION < 4.3) {
return session_is_registered($variable);
}
else {
return isset($_SESSION) && array_key_exists($variable, $_SESSION);
}
}
Function isUserLogin() {
global $db;
if (session_registered('id') && session_registered('password')) {
$userid = $_SESSION['id'];
//$username = $_SESSION['username'];
$password = $_SESSION['password'];
$verify = $db->query("SELECT * FROM accounts WHERE id=$userid");
$verify_rows = $db->num_rows($verify);
if ($verify_rows>=1) {
//$passnow = GetPasswordNow($username);
$infouser = $db->fetch_array($verify);
if($infouser['password'] == $password) {
return $infouser;
}
else {
return false;
}
}
else {
return false;
}
}
}
Function isServerOn() {
global $db;
global $config;
<b><font color=red>[Chỉ có thành viên mới xem link được. <a href="register.php"> Nhấp đây để đăng ký thành viên......</a>]</font></b>
if ($check) {
return "<font color=green><b>On!</b></font>";
}
else {
return "<font color=red><b>Off!</b></font>";
}
}
Function isOnline() {
global $db;
$q = $db->query("SELECT * FROM accounts where loggedin = 2");
if ($db->num_rows($q)>0) {
return $db->num_rows($q);
}
else {
return 0;
}
}
function genRandomString($length) {

$characters = '0123456789abcdefghijklmnopqrstuvwxyz';
$string = '';
for ($p = 0; $p < $length; $p++) {
$string .= $characters[mt_rand(0, strlen($characters))];
}
return $string;
}
?>

Xephyr là tên sv các bạn có thể đổi tên j tùy thích
và để vào game thì phải chỉnh IP ở redirector nữa do mình xài V114 nên file chỉnh IP của mình là Redirector.ini
vậy là xong thử vào web = IP của hamachi và đăng kí xem :D

shell1508
31-03-13, 10:41 PM
:))) Làm 1 cái cho ae thử đi pthing :)))

pthinh145
01-04-13, 03:40 PM
:))) Làm 1 cái cho ae thử đi pthing :)))
làm rồi mà lâu lâu có ng` vào bị yes, no tắt sv mở lại mới zô đc :D

lyvanphat1990
11-04-13, 04:38 PM
Mình xài bản v117 thì Redirector có dùng được ko?

Bạn giúp mình, hướng dẫn mình đưa bản v117 này lên onl đc không?

Bạn cho mình xin nick yahoo nhé! Hoặc add nick yahoo của mình traibonbon_ik. Thanks bạn nhìu.

pthinh145
25-04-13, 03:05 PM
đã up hướng dẫn 30char............